java默認類
發布時間: 2025-07-14 16:51:03
① java的基本數據類型有哪些 java基本數據類型有哪幾種
JAVA中一共有八種基本數據類型,分別是:
- byte:8位,最大存儲數據量是255,存放的數據范圍是-128~127之間。
- short:16位,用於存儲較小的整數。
- int:32位,Java中默認的整數類型,用於存儲常見的整數。
- long:64位,用於存儲較大的整數,需要在數字後面加L或l表示。
- float:32位,單精度浮點數,用於存儲小數,需要在數字後面加F或f表示。
- double:64位,雙精度浮點數,Java中默認的浮點數類型,精度比float更高。
- char:16位,用於存儲單個字元,採用Unicode編碼。
- boolean:表示邏輯值,只有兩個取值true和false。
這些基本數據類型在Java中是預先定義好的,它們直接存儲在棧內存中,與引用數據類型(如類、介面和數組等)相比,具有更高的訪問效率和更低的內存開銷。在學習Java時,理解並掌握這些基本數據類型是非常重要的基礎。
② java中的類如果不標明是public或private類,默認是什麼
默認的是default 不需要書寫
public: Java語言中訪問限制最寬的修飾符,一般稱之為「公共的」。被其修飾的類、屬性以及方法不
僅可以跨類訪問,而且允許跨包(package)訪問。
private: Java語言中對訪問許可權限制的最窄的修飾符,一般稱之為「私有的」。被其修飾的類、屬性以
及方法只能被該類的對象訪問,其子類不能訪問,更不能允許跨包訪問。
protect: 介於public 和 private 之間的一種訪問修飾符,一般稱之為「保護形」。被其修飾的類、
屬性以及方法只能被類本身的方法及子類訪問,即使子類在不同的包中也可以訪問。
default:即不加任何訪問修飾符,通常稱為「默認訪問模式「。該模式下,只允許在同一個包中進行訪
問。
熱點內容